Output 8749e131b7ce7d139c46dd18c28ef98654a1bed84d28624542d8ab76ec3c259f:18

value
2729869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 131b9c76c16cf920ee2cf9832c30ebf4b63d8b91 OP_EQUAL
address
33S3qeWFMinqDuGT5zTaTWWeEuM8bgffUQ
transaction
8749e131b7ce7d139c46dd18c28ef98654a1bed84d28624542d8ab76ec3c259f